Search locations or food
OR
Sign up

Odinsborg

Uppsala, Sweden

4.1
602
Odinsborg | TasteAtlas | Recommended authentic restaurants
Odinsborg | TasteAtlas | Recommended authentic restaurants
Odinsborg | TasteAtlas | Recommended authentic restaurants
Odinsborg | TasteAtlas | Recommended authentic restaurants
Odinsborg | TasteAtlas | Recommended authentic restaurants
Odinsborg | TasteAtlas | Recommended authentic restaurants
Ärnavägen 4, 754 40 Uppsala, Sweden +46 18 32 35 25

Have you eaten at Odinsborg recently?

Are you the owner of Odinsborg?
Contact us and tell us more about your restaurant
editorial@tasteatlas.com

Explore more